Sector ETF Investing: Diversification and Targeted Returns

Sector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s) provide a compelling avenue for investors seeking diversification within specific industry segments. By allocating to sector ETFs, you can zero in on particular areas of the market that align with your financial goals.

The merit of sector ETFs lies in their ability to provide concentrated influence to a particular sector, allowing investors to exploit potential growth. For example, an investor bullish on the technology sector could invest in a IT ETF to gain direct exposure to this growing industry.

Conversely, investors seeking diversification can utilize sector ETFs to spread their risk across multiple industries. A investment strategy comprised of various sector ETFs can help minimize overall portfolio volatility and provide a more balanced investment approach.

  • Remember to conduct thorough research before purchasing in any ETF, considering factors such as expense ratios, fund performance, and the specific sector's potential.
  • Consult a financial advisor to determine if sector ETFs are appropriate for your individual financial objectives.

Exploring S&P 500 Sector ETFs: Opportunities and Risks

Sector-specific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s) tracking the movements of various sectors within the S&P 500 offer investors allocation to specific industries. These ETFs can provide opportunities for capital increase by capitalizing on the strength of booming sectors. However, it's vital to recognize the inherent risks associated with sector-specific investments.

Factors such as global conditions, regulatory changes, and market pressures can negatively impact the returns of sector ETFs.

A strategic portfolio often includes a mix of sector ETFs to minimize risk and maximize potential returns. It's critical for investors to undertake thorough research before committing capital to any sector ETF, evaluating their investment aims, risk tolerance, and investment timeframe.
